Exercise 9



The Cantor set in the interval [0,1] is constructed by removing the interval ]1/3,2/3[ leaving the two intervals [0,1/3] and [2/3,1]. Frome these the middle third is removed and so on. Assume that the Cantor set is the active set for turbulence.



What is the probability, Pl, of finding an active region at the level l. What is the fractal dimension of the Cantor set.



Using the $\beta$-model, calculate the anomalous scaling exponents, $\zeta_p$ in this case.
